MOTOR OUTRAGES.
THREE ARRESTS MADE. By Cable—Prew Association—Copyright. Paris, March 31. Three arrests have been effected at Chantilly, including Soudy, an Anarchist, who is supposed to have stood guard outside the bank while it was being robbed. . A FANATICAI/ANARCHIST. Received 2, 12.15 a.m. Paris, April 1. Soudy is a consumptive, twenty years of age, and is known as a reckless and fanatical anarchist. He attempted 4o swallow poison when arrested.
